  1. This is an old cure for warts. Get a snail and put it on a thorn and keep the snail on the wart and as soon as the snail is dying the wart is fading away.
    The cure for chiblains is to get a turnip and cut a hole and put salt in it and hold it in front of the fire to melt and rub it well to the chilblain
